Free AI Prompt: Peer Play Reinforcement Script
This prompt allows early childhood educators to instantly generate a highly customized, age-appropriate reinforcement script for a specific peer play scenario. By providing key details about the situation, such as the age of the children involved and the desired behavior being reinforced, the AI can craft a script that not only addresses the issue at hand but also aligns with the developmental needs and language comprehension levels of the children.
You are an early childhood educator tasked with reinforcing positive peer play behaviors in a classroom setting.
Generate a highly detailed, professional reinforcement script for a scenario involving [Age Group] children. The desired behavior to reinforce is [Behavior, e.g., sharing toys]. The context of the situation is that the children are engaged in [Activity Type, e.g., building blocks together]. Structure your prompt to include specific strategies and language that would be most effective with this age group, taking into account their cognitive abilities, language comprehension levels, and social-emotional development.
Do not use real PII.

Use this prompt to generate a customized script for addressing conflicts during peer play activities. This will help educators guide children through the resolution process, fostering empathy and understanding among participants. By providing details about the ages of the involved children and the nature of their conflict, the AI can craft an age-appropriate approach that promotes problem-solving skills.
You are an early childhood educator tasked with guiding [Age Group] children through a peer play conflict. The nature of the conflict is that two children, [Child 1 Name] and [Child 2 Name], have been arguing over [Conflict Details, e.g., who gets to use the swings].
Generate a highly detailed, professional script for resolving this conflict in an educational yet age-appropriate manner. Include strategies that promote empathy, understanding, and problem-solving skills among the children involved.
Do not use real PII.
